Web28 jul. 2024 · What do I do if my dog ate diaper rash cream? Any pets who ingest zinc oxide ointment should be monitored for GI upset. Fluids may be required if pets have GI upset that is significant enough to cause dehydration. Hypersensitivity reactions may require treatment with antihistamines and corticosteroids. WebIt’s perfectly safe to use diaper rash cream on your dog. However, it’s important your dog does not ingest the cream. Most diaper rash creams contain Zinc Oxide. When consumed in excessive amounts, it can cause abdominal pain, diarrhea, vomiting, and loss of appetite. There’s little worse in this world than seeing your furry friend suffer ... WebIt is good that your dog vomited, bad that he ate diaper rash ointment as it containes zinc oxide. Zinc is very toxic to dogs. I would play it safe because in the event he didn't vomit all of it up he can become very ill from this. You better go see an ER vet tonight and get supportive treatment underway.
